What it costs to buy a home in 45638
A household needs to earn about $33,000 a year to comfortably buy the median 45638 home, at 20% down and today's 30-year rate. That is below the area's own median income of $58,108, so a typical household can afford the median home outright.
Where the monthly payment goes
Assumes a 20% down payment, a 6.6% 30-year fixed rate, and a 28% share of income going to the payment. The rate is the 2026-07-23 30-year fixed average, series MORTGAGE30US from the St. Louis Fed, which publishes Freddie Mac's weekly survey. Against the median home value, property tax uses 45638's effective rate of 1.01%, and insurance is estimated at 0.4% of home value a year.

What the weather is like in 45638, month by month
45638 sees roughly 57 pleasant days a year. July highs average about 89 degrees. January highs sit near 46, with lows near 25. The comfortable stretch runs April through June and August through October.
Show the monthly temperatures
| Month | Avg high | Avg | Avg low |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 46° | 34° | 25° |
| April | 70° | 55° | 42° |
| July | 89° | 76° | 67° |
| October | 73° | 58° | 47° |
Flying in and out of 45638
The nearest airport, Tri-State/Milton J Ferguson Field, is about 13 miles away and is a small airport. The nearest major hub is John Glenn Columbus International, about 102 miles away.

Sources and methodology
Every measure on this page is scored for each neighborhood, then rolled up to 45638. Scores are absolute rather than ranked, which means a 60 in 45638 represents the same real quantity as a 60 anywhere else, and the ranking is a weighted average of those absolutes. The map colors come from a national scale calibrated against a population weighted random sample of 5,000 neighborhoods. That absolute scoring is what no other places-to-live ranking does: it puts a single neighborhood, a town, a metro, and a state on one scale, so the same 40 measures answer both which metro to move to and which street inside it to buy on.
